Welcome to the art room!

Timberlake art classes individualize instruction according to each student’s needs including those pursuing art as a hobby or as a career. All classes have a focus on technique and Art creation skills.  We work on short- and long-term projects, and explore various media. Overall there is an emphasis on developing the individuals unique creative vision.

Other topics include the study of Art History, Artists, and how Art affects our everyday culture.

We suggest all students take Art 1 for two semesters to provide a  solid foundation for further education in the arts. Consult the student handbook, counseling staff or Ms. Scozzaro for more information.
